Hickory Tree Removal in Bucks County, PA

Hickory tree removal services involve the careful and efficient removal of mature or unwanted hickory trees from residential properties. These projects can include removing dead or damaged trees, clearing space for new construction or landscaping, or managing trees that pose safety concerns due to their size or location. Homeowners typically seek these services to improve safety, prevent property damage, or enhance the appearance of their landscape. It’s important for property owners to understand the scope of the work, including potential impacts on the surrounding area, and to consider factors such as tree size, accessibility, and any required permits before requesting removal.

Before requesting hickory tree removal, property owners should assess the condition of the tree and determine whether professional removal is necessary. They should also consider the potential effects on their landscape, nearby structures, and utility lines. Clarifying the reasons for removal-such as disease, safety, or aesthetic improvements-can help ensure the project meets expectations. Understanding the process involved and any associated considerations can support a smooth and effective removal, contributing to the safety and visual appeal of the property.

FAQ

Hickory Tree Removal Questions

When is tree removal necessary? Tree removal may be needed due to disease, damage, or safety concerns related to overgrown or unstable trees.

What types of trees are commonly removed? Commonly removed trees include dead or dying trees, those obstructing structures, or species that pose a risk to nearby property.

How does tree removal affect the landscape? Removing a tree can improve visibility, prevent damage to structures, and create space for new planting or development.

What should property owners consider before removing a tree? Consider the tree’s location, size, and condition, as well as any potential impact on surrounding plants or structures.
